FREDONIA — A Fredonia-Stockton Road traffic stop led to DWI charges for one man on Wednesday.

According to New York State Police, Layne B. Fox, no age or address given, was pulled over for speeding, and after failing several field sobriety tests, was placed under arrest.

Fox was transported to the State Police barracks in Jamestown where he provided a breath sample of .17.  He was then processed, issued tickets returnable to the Town of Pomfret Court, and released to a sober individual.
